Director of religious activities vs college ministry pastor

The differences between directors of religious activities and college ministry pastors can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. It typically takes 2-4 years to become both a director of religious activities and a college ministry pastor. Additionally, a director of religious activities has an average salary of $61,176, which is higher than the $43,292 average annual salary of a college ministry pastor.
